Koto-no-ito
Common Name: Koto-no-ito
Scientific Name: Acer palmatum 'Koto-no-ito'
Species: Japanese Maple
Category: Semi-dwarf tree
Habit: Deciduous
Flower Description: Inconspicuous
Bloom Season: Blooms in spring
Fragrance: No fragrance
Foliage Description: This older bamboo leaf variety is always in high demand. The leaves emerge bright green in spring changing to medium green for summer. Fall color is beautiful crimson
Height of Plant: 6-10 ft.
Spread of Plant: 6-10 ft.
Hardiness: USDA Zones 5a - 8b
Other Information: Name means "Strings of a Harp" in Japanese
